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
193 93539356741 74 691254
9393 637004425 51067088
9393 637004425 51067088
71 8764337721 66245 9753179585 23
All about undefined
Interested in learning more?
9393 637004425 51067088
71 8764337721 66245 9753179585 23
See more
778675 4444769387 58993616
7825888795 3023 73
See more
363 3815 13995999031
25147532076 13637716226 3191018
See more